navybankerteacher Posted January 7, 2015 #3 Share Posted January 7, 2015 Either Coastal or Avis - both right at the cruise terminal - are good; Hertz tends to be significantly more expensive on the island for some reason, and I do not feel comfortable dealing with the no-name outfits, who may or may not honor a reservation. You definitely want to reserve on line in advance to make sure the type vehicle you want will be available at a price you are comfortable with. Driving on the island is OK - watch out for the occasional pot hole. I would recommend that you finish the day on the north or east side of the island - say Orient Beach or Dawn Beach so you will not get snagged in the very heavy traffic coming through from the west side (where Marigot is), and you could plan on hitting the stores in Phillipsburg just before dropping off the car, if shopping is in your plan.
